Inclusion Criteria:
- Give written informed consent to participate.
- Age 18 - 49 years old.
- Judged suitable by the PI, as determined by medical history, physical examination, vital signs, and clinical safety laboratory examinations.
- Willing to use oral, implantable, transdermal or injectable contraceptives, or sexual abstinence, from screening and until 28 days after second vaccine dose.
- Willing to adhere to the requirements of the study and willing and able to communicate with the Investigator and understand the requirements of the study.
Exclusion Criteria:
- Abnormal screening hematology or chemistry value per the FDA Toxicity Guidance.
- Pulse rate or blood pressure outside the reference range for this study population and considered as clinically significant by the Investigator.
- Has an acute or chronic medical condition or history of a medical condition that, in the opinion of the Investigator, would render the study procedures unsafe or would interfere with the evaluation of the responses.
- Presence or clinically significant history of lung disease, asthma, chronic obstructive pulmonary disease (COPD), or otherwise poor lung function.
- Any confirmed or suspected immunosuppressive or immunodeficient state.
- Presence of household member or close personal or professional (i.e., healthcare worker) who is a child under one year of age; is pregnant; has known immunodeficiency or is receiving immunosuppressant medication; is undergoing or soon to undergo cancer chemotherapy; has been diagnosed with emphysema, COPD, or other severe lung disease and resides in a nursing home; and/or has received a bone marrow or solid organ transplant.
- Females who are pregnant or lactating.
- Acute febrile illness within 72 hours prior to vaccination.
- Any condition, in the opinion of the Investigator, (such as subjects who have medically high-risk conditions) that might interfere with the primary study objectives for safety of the study subject.

EXPERIMENTAL: Low dose Sing2016 M2SR
Low dose Sing2016 M2SR will be administered intranasally on days 1 and 29
|
This group will receive a low dose of the Sing2016 M2SR H3N2 monovalent influenza vaccine administered intranasally.
|
|
EXPERIMENTAL: Medium dose Sing2016 M2SR
Medium dose Sing2016 M2SR will be administered intranasally on days 1 and 29
|
This group will receive a medium dose of the Sing2016 M2SR H3N2 monovalent influenza vaccine administered intranasally.
|
|
EXPERIMENTAL: High dose Sing2016 M2SR
High dose Sing2016 M2SR will be administered intranasally on days 1 and 29
|
This group will receive a high dose of the Sing2016 M2SR H3N2 monovalent influenza vaccine administered intranasally.
|
|
ACTIVE_COMPARATOR: Low dose Bris10 M2SR
Low dose Bris10 M2SR will be administered intranasally on days 1 and 29
|
This group will receive a low dose of the Bris10 M2SR H3N2 monovalent influenza vaccine administered intranasally.
|
|
PLACEBO_COMPARATOR: Placebo
Saline will be administered intranasally on days 1 and 29
|
This group will receive saline placebo administered intranasally.
